Can link to an example? The only thing I can think of is パソコンの性能ボトルネック. A bottleneck is a limitation of throughput for a downstream activity. Example: If you can only make 10 Widget A an hour, and 20 Widget B an hours. Each Widget B requires 1 Widget A. This means the max Widget B production rate is...
